WORD MEDITATION: 17/09/2018

Posted on

Bible Reading: 2 Chro. 15; 1 Thes.1:1-10.

“And all Judah rejoiced at the oath: for they had sworn with all their heart, and sought him with their whole desire; and he was found of them: and the Lord gave them rest round about.” – 2 Chronicles 15:15 (KJV).

When you seek to please God as we stated yesterday, there are a number of benefits that will accrue to you. Firstly, your prayers get answered ( John 15:16). You will have rest on all sides. 2 Chronicles 15:15 (KJV) says: “And all Judah rejoiced at the oath: for they had sworn with all their heart, and sought him with their whole desire; and he was found of them: and the Lord gave them rest round about.”

Because the children of Judah decided to seek the Lord with all their heart, they found him and got rest all around them. Seeking God with all their heart means they feared the Lord. And as long as you fear the Lord, He will put his fear on all your enemies such that they will be afraid of facing you because of God. Going by this, getting rest all around them implies rest from all forms of war at a time that war was very rampant. But for an individual, it means rest from diseases, afflictions and storms of various types. However for this to continue, you need to remain steadfast in pleasing God. This is why you are expected to pray to God without ceasing (1 Thessalonians 5:17).

Pleasing God does not imply that there will not be occasional challenges in your life but that He will always be there to provide the necessary way out such that you will come out victorious at all times. That is why the bible says in Romans 8:37 KJV “Nay, in all these things we are more than conquerors through him that loved us.” Sometimes, your faith is tested to ascertain  the level of your commitment to God. This is trial of faith.  Job went through this but at the end of the trial he became twice better than he was. Job 42:10 (KJV): “And the Lord turned the captivity of Job, when he prayed for his friends: also the Lord gave Job twice as much as he had before.” Every trial of faith you may be going through, God will turn around for you this day in Jesus name.

Prayer point: Father as I continue to please you, please let my end be better than my beginning and let me finish well in Jesus name.
